多智能体系统在智能城市中是如何运作的?

多智能体系统在智能城市中是如何运作的?

"智能城市中的多代理系统由多个自主代理组成,这些代理共同工作以管理和优化各种城市服务和过程。这些代理可以通过软件程序、传感器,甚至是与环境相互作用的机器人来表示。其主要目标是提高城市生活的效率、可持续性和质量。例如,交通管理代理可以与公共交通系统进行通信,根据实时交通状况调整时间表,从而减少拥堵并增强出行便利性。

多代理系统中的每个代理都有自己的目标,并可以独立运行,但它们也会合作以实现共同目标。例如,环境监测代理可以收集空气质量水平的数据,而能源管理代理则评估电网的电力消耗。通过共享这些数据,系统可以优化能源使用,警告居民污染水平,或触发自动响应,例如在高耗能区域减少能源消耗。这种协作方法帮助系统更有效地应对动态城市条件。

从开发者的角度来看,实现多代理系统需要对代理架构和通信协议有充分的理解。像JADE(Java Agent Development Framework)这样的工具可以促进此类系统的开发,提供代理管理和交互的功能。通过设计既自主又合作的代理,开发者能够使智能城市迅速适应挑战并持续改善服务交付,从而使城市环境更具响应能力和效率。"

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
多智能体系统是如何工作的?
多智能体系统(MAS)由多个相互作用的智能体组成,这些智能体能够自主行动以实现特定目标。这些系统中的每个智能体通常都具有自己的规则、能力和目标。智能体可以代表从软件应用到机器人实体的任何事物,它们通过相互之间的沟通和协调来解决通常单个智能体
Read Now
知识蒸馏是什么?
在神经网络中,特别是在序列到序列模型中,编码器负责处理输入数据并将其压缩为固定大小的表示,通常称为上下文或潜在向量。此表示包含预测输出所需的基本信息。 另一方面,解码器获取该压缩信息并生成相应的输出,例如语言翻译任务中的翻译或文本生成任务
Read Now
愿景人工智能如何个性化客户体验?
Arduino中的编码对于理解硬件-软件集成的基础很有用,但在计算机视觉方面的应用有限。Arduino平台专为控制传感器、执行器和简单设备而设计,非常适合涉及物联网或机器人的项目。虽然Arduino缺乏计算机视觉任务的计算能力,但它可以通过
Read Now

AI Assistant